CVE-2026-4542

CVE-2026-4542 is a medium-severity vulnerability with a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.4.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-22.

Key facts

Description

A vulnerability has been found in SSCMS 4.7.0. The affected element is an unknown function of the file LayerImageController.Submit.cs of the component layerImage Endpoint. Such manipulation of the argument filePaths leads to path traversal. The attack may be performed from remote.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used.

How severe is CVE-2026-4542?
CVE-2026-4542 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.4,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ity low, and availability low.
Is CVE-2026-4542 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(23rd perc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Does CVE-2026-4542 have an EU (EUVD) identifier?
Yes. CVE-2026-4542 is tracked in the ENISA EU Vulnerability Database (EUVD) as EUVD-2026-14294.
When was CVE-2026-4542 published?
CVE-2026-4542 was published on 2026-03-22 and last updated on 2026-06-17.
